/* Allgemeine Formatierungen */
*{
 margin:0;
 padding:0;
}

body{
 background:#eee;
 font:14px "trebuchet ms", arial, sans-serif;
 text-align:center;
 background-image:url(../fond.gif);
}


/* Formatierungen Layout (grob) */
#seite{
/* background:#fff url(../PHOTOS/hintergrund.jpg) repeat-y;*/

 padding:20px 13px 3px 13px;
 text-align:left;
 width:715px;
 background-color:#FFFFFF;
 margin: 10px auto 10px auto;
 position: relative;
 border: 1px solid #CFCFCF;
 -moz-border-radius:6px;
 border-radius:6px;
}

#seitepourroulottescentrees{
/* background:#fff url(../PHOTOS/hintergrund.jpg) repeat-y;*/

 padding:20px 13px 3px 13px;
 
 width:715px;
 background-color:#FFFFFF;
 margin: 10px auto 10px auto;
 position: relative;
 border: 1px solid #CFCFCF;
 -moz-border-radius:6px;
 border-radius:6px;
}

#oben{
 background:#fff;
 clear:both;
 height:168px;
 width:713px;
 border-left:solid;
 border-right:solid;
 border-top:solid;
 border-color:#38813A;
 border-width:1px;
}

#whereiam{
font:6px;
margin-left:20px;
color:#38813A;
}

#links{
 float:left;
 margin:0 0 20px 0;
 width:700px;
}

#links2colonnes{
 float:left;
 margin:0 0 0 20px 0;
 width:508px;
 	background-image: url(../Couts/petitcheval1.jpg);
	background-repeat: no-repeat;
	background-position:bottom left;

}

#rechts{
 float:left;
 margin:0 0 0 0;
 width:185px
}

#fotorechts{
margin-top:20px;
}

#Texte{
font:14px;
margin-left:25px;
margin-right:25px;
color:#333333;
}

#RoulottesCentreesImageDroite{
	font:14px;
	margin-left:25px;
	margin-right:25px;
	color:#333333;
	text-align:center;
	background-image: url(../Couts/petitcheval2.jpg);
	background-repeat: no-repeat;
	background-position: right 0;
}

#RoulottesCentreesImageGauche{
	font:14px;
	margin-left:25px;
	margin-right:25px;
	color:#333333;
	text-align:center;
	background-image: url(../Couts/petitcheval1.jpg);
	background-repeat: no-repeat;
	background-position: left 0;
}

#TexteLocation{
font:14px;
margin-left:25px;
margin-right:25px;
padding-left:25px;
padding-right:35px;
padding-top:25px;
padding-bottom:25px;
color:#333333;
border: thin solid #38813A;
}

#TexteLocation img {border:1px solid #38813A}

#Citation{
  margin-left:100px;
  margin-right:100px;
  border: thin solid #38813A;
  padding-left:15px;
  padding-right:15px;
  padding-top:15px;
 }

#Citation2{
  margin-left:25px;
  margin-right:25px;
  border: thin solid #38813A;
  padding-left:15px;
  padding-right:15px;
  padding-top:15px;
  text-align:center;
 }

#unten{
 clear:both;
 width:713px;
 -moz-border-radius:6px;
 border-radius:6px;
 border-left:solid;
 border-right:solid;
 border-top:solid;
 border-bottom:solid;
 border-color:#38813A;
 border-width:1px;
}

.cadreliens {
  background-color:#EEEEEE;
  padding:10px;
  padding-left:80px;
  border-color:#009900;
  border-style:solid;
  border-width:1px;
  margin-bottom:3px;
  	-moz-border-radius:6px;
	border-radius:6px;
}

/* Formatierungen Navigationsleiste */
#navigation{
 background:#DBDBDB;
 float:left;
 width:713px;
 padding:0 0 2px 0;
 border-left:solid;
 border-right:solid;
 border-bottom:solid;
 border-color:#38813A;
 border-width:1px;
 }

#navigation ul{
}

#navigation ul li{
 display:inline;
 margin:0 10px 0 0 
}

#navigation ul li a{
 text-decoration:none;
 border-bottom:2px solid #DBDBDB;
 color:#38813A;
 font-size:13px; 
 font-weight:bold;
}

#navigation ul li a:hover{
 text-decoration:none;
 border-bottom:2px solid red;
}

#navigation ul li a:active{ color: red; 
 text-decoration:none;
 border-bottom:2px solid red;
}


/* Sonstige Formatierungen */
.titel{
 float:right;
 width:90px;
 padding:0 10px 0 0
}

.titel img{
 border:0
}

/* Schrift-Formatierungen */
h1,h2,h3,h4,h5,h6{
 border-bottom:1px solid #38813A;
 color:#38813A;
 font-size:20px;
 letter-spacing:1px;
 margin:25px 0 0 0
}

#links p{
 text-align:justify
}

#unten p{
 color:#6D6D6D;
 font:11px "trebuchet ms", verdana, sans-serif;
 padding:5px;
}

/* Formatierungen Navigation (linke Spalte) */
#links ul{
list-style:none;
 margin:0 0 0 0
}

#links ul li{
 background:url(../PHOTOS/liste.jpg) no-repeat;
 display:block;
  margin:0 0px 0 50px;
 padding:0 0 0 16px
}

#links ul li a{
 text-decoration:none;
  color:#38813A;
}

#links ul li a:hover{
  color:#000;
}



/* Link-Formatierungen */
a:link,a:visited,a:active{
	color:#38813A;
	text-decoration:underline
}

a:hover{
 text-decoration:none
}


#unten a{
 color:#6D6D6D;
 text-decoration:underline
}

#unten a:hover{
 text-decoration:none
}

#links ul li{
 background:url(../PHOTOS/liste.jpg) no-repeat;
 display:block;
  margin:0 0px 0 50px;
 padding:0 0 0 16px
}

#links ul li a{
 text-decoration:none;
  color:#38813A;
}

#links ul li a:hover{
  color:#000;
}

#links2colonnes ul li{
 background:url(../PHOTOS/liste.jpg) no-repeat;
 display:block;
  margin:0 0px 0 50px;
 padding:0 0 0 16px
}

#links2colonnes ul li a{
 text-decoration:none;
  color:#38813A;
}

#links2colonnes ul li a:hover{
  color:#000;
}
